I don't know if this has been posted before.
It would be cool if mechanics could paint your vehicle for 75-100$ max , in order to paint someone else vehicle the mechanic must buy a spray can from Brucie Garage or any Tuning Shop , the spray can should cost around 25-50$.
To avoid flooding and make it a bit realistic, spraying a vehicle will take from 10 to 60 seconds ( feel free to discuss about this ). Imo this can raise a little bit the roleplay, but as we know its the players and not the scripts that have to start RP.
I was thinking to add also a sort of cooperation perk, for example if you paint a vehicle with another mechanic (Both must stay close each other and have a spray can in their invent) you both get a little bonus from 25 to 50$.
Some cmd examples could be:
/offerpaintjob [id] [price] (yep stole it from samp kek) ;
/accept & /refuse ;
/offerpaintjob2 [id 2nd mechanic] [id player] [price];
Or to avoid [price], just using /setfee , the fee price should be taken from the first mechanic.

Part 2
As Anonete said we will need to preview the color, it would be great if there is a timelapse of 5-10 seconds in which we could get a preview of the color. Instead of adding a new cmd like /trycolor it could work like this:
Player A offered you a paintjob. Type /accept to preview the color
Player B types /accept and gets another prompt: "Type /accept again to confirm the color change."
Player A gets prompted: "Player B has accepted your paintjob, you earned XX $."
This is just a draft. /Discuss
